Why is mid-decade redistricting happening now? One of the most straight forward reasons is President Donald Trump doesn’t want to lose control of the U.S. House in 2026. And that’s likely true!
In fact, many Republican state lawmakers have received the assignment from the President and have been happy to follow the President in breaking historical norms with mid-decade redistricting.
Here’s what some of them are saying:
But is that the only goal?
Because a disturbing trend has appeared — Trump is also targeting majority Black voter districts.
In Missouri, Trump and state lawmakers split a current Congressional district with a majority of black voters in half. In North Carolina, Trump and Republican lawmakers cracked the “Black Belt” district in eastern NC. Now, Trump and some Republicans want to do the same in Indiana, targeting two separate centers of black voters’ power.
It’s no secret Republicans want to dismantle the Voting Rights Act and Black and brown voting power all together.
So is mid-decade redistricting another underhanded way of splitting minority voting power via Congressional representation?
3 times in a row sure looks like it….
